Seems most tree guys I observe, the first thing they do when they get to the job is take the gas can and scrench off the truck and tote them to the back yard. In 30 years of doing tree work I have never had the need to relocate the gas can or scrench off the truck on ANY job. Leave the tools and gas on the truck instead of toting them all around the yard and you won't lose them as often.
Not saying that's the case for you, just something I see often enough and it baffles me why people insist on making their job harder than necessary.
The only time you need to tote your gas can and tools is if you are logging in the woods.
